Winning is always nice, but doing so behind a season-high score is even better (just ask Milton). Everything went their way against the Gainesville Red Elephants on Thursday as they made off with a 17-2 victory. The win was nothing new for the Eagles as they're now sitting on four straight.
Elizabeth Wilkes was incredible, going a perfect 2-for-2 with three runs, three RBI, and one stolen base. That's the most RBI she has posted since back in August of 2024. Another player making a difference was Sophia Kirby, who went 2-for-3 with three RBI, one run, and one double.
Milton was getting hits left and right and finished the game having posted a batting average of .500. That was just more of the same: they've now posted a batting average of .424 or higher in three consecutive matchups.
Milton now has a winning record of 6-5. As for Gainesville, their loss ended a three-game streak of away wins and brought them to 4-2.
We've got plenty of inter-region action coming up soon. Milton is set to challenge their familiar foe Seckinger at 6:30 p.m. on Tuesday. Meanwhile, Gainesville will face off against rival Lanier at 5:00 p.m. on Tuesday.
